I picked up a 14 plate V40 D3 R-Design Lux Nav yesterday. So far, love it. Suffers on pot holes and speed bumps, but apart from that feels great.

I've seen a lot of pictures online that show a speed limit in the bottom right of the main driver's display, I assume from a speed camera warning. Although I have the warnings enabled and get the beep in my car, I don't see this, regardless what theme I have the car in. The only way I can figure out what the speed limit I'm being warned about is is to have it in sat nav mode (doesn't have to be running a route), and get the speed on the main display, not the drivers one.

Am I missing something obvious? Does it only work when you're actually using the sat nav? Is it part of the year 15 Sensus upgrade, or some other special feature?

That requires the 'Road Sign Information Display' option, which I believe was only ever available as part of a ~£2k driver support pack. This reads the signs using a camera and then displays them.

The one you see as part of the sat nav is from the maps, so doesn't always match if the signs have changed or in roadworks etc.
